God Damn To Support Thrice In London And Nottingham

Friday, 17 February 2017 Written by Jon Stickler

God Damn will play as main support to Thrice in London and Nottingham this spring.

The Wolverhampton punk trio will join the Californian post-hardcore band at KOKO on April 27 and Rock City the next day, following up their headline date at Brixton Jamm in London on March 9. They have also been confirmed for this summer's Download festival.

God Damn released 'Everything Ever' in September through One Little Indian Records. Thrice, meanwhile, are touring behind 'To Be Everywhere Is to Be Nowhere’, also released last year.

Thrice Upcoming Tour Dates are as follows

Thu April 27 2017 - LONDON KOKO
Fri April 28 2017 - NOTTINGHAM Rock City
